The market

What selling online in Toronto actually looks like

The GTA is the largest concentration of consumer-goods trade in Canada, and it is unusually vertically stacked. The old garment trade around Spadina and King West still supplies apparel labels that now sell direct. Import and wholesale businesses founded by first-generation families in Scarborough, North York and Markham are a genuine engine of the local product economy — a lot of Canadian DTC brands are the second generation of an importer, not a venture-funded startup. The Ontario Food Terminal in Etobicoke is the country's largest wholesale produce market, and the warehouse belt strung along the 401 through Mississauga and Brampton is where nearly every Canadian 3PL keeps its east-coast node.

Category-wise, Toronto punches hardest in beauty and skincare, jewellery and accessories, intimates and apparel, and cold-weather technical outerwear — the city produced several of the beauty and jewellery brands that gave Canadian DTC its international reputation. The common thread is that these are brands whose largest single market is the United States while their operations, staff and inventory sit in Ontario. That one fact drives most of the technical work: cross-border pricing, landed-cost transparency, US-facing customer service hours, and a shipping story that does not fall apart at the border.

Verticals

Who we build for in Toronto

The categories that dominate Toronto’s commerce economy — and what each one needs from a Shopify build.

01

Beauty & skincare

Ingredient-led ranges need regimen bundling, refill subscriptions and INCI-accurate content — all standard Shopify app-stack work, and all localisable per market.

02

Jewellery & accessories

Made-to-order sizing, engraving and gifting windows need real variant and lead-time logic, plus fraud-safe checkout at higher AOVs.

03

Outerwear & cold-weather technical

A brutally short selling season means the storefront has to be tested and ready in August, not fixed in December.

04

Second-generation importers going direct

A wholesale catalogue is not a product catalogue. Shopify lets one business run B2B price lists and a DTC storefront off a single inventory source.

05

Food, snacks & functional CPG

Bilingual labelling, provincial shipping restrictions and perishability all need handling at the shipping-profile level, not in a policy page nobody reads.

Why us, here

What we do differently for Toronto brands

Two priced markets, not a currency converter

A live FX widget gives you ugly prices and no margin control. We set USD as its own market with its own price list, rounding and shipping rates, so the American buyer sees a store that looks built for them.

Landed cost at the border, shown at checkout

Cross-border parcels that arrive with a surprise bill get refused, and a refused parcel costs you twice. We configure duty and import tax collection so the customer sees the full number before they pay.

A French storefront that actually works

Navigation, filters, cart, checkout, transactional email and Klaviyo flows all have to follow the language switch. Translating the homepage and stopping there is how brands fail Quebec buyers and compliance at the same time.

Almost never. Shopify Markets gives you US pricing, USD checkout, US-specific shipping rates and localised content on one store and one admin. Running two stores means two catalogues, two apps bills and two sets of inventory drift. The exception is a genuinely different assortment or brand name in each country.

You plan for it before it happens. That means at least one courier rate live in every shipping profile, a lightweight banner and email flow ready to explain delays, and a delivery-estimate block on the product page that reflects the carrier actually being used. Brands that only wire this up mid-disruption lose the peak weeks while they scramble.

Usually not until checkout customisation, B2B on Shopify, or transaction-fee maths make the case on their own. Plenty of Toronto brands doing several million a year run beautifully on standard Shopify with a well-built theme. We would rather put that money into cross-border configuration and retention, which pay back faster.
